Specifying Extensions for Telesets


This section describes how to specify extensions for telesets. After you specify telesets, agents, and extensions, the agent who uses the teleset must specify a default standard extension from the teleset that he or she is associated with. The agent does not need to specify a default standard extension if the teleset is a hoteling teleset. For details, see Setting Communications User Preferences.

The way you specify extension data varies according to the switch you are using. Table 5 documents how extension type must be specified (S or A) for each of the switches supported in the communications configurations provided by Siebel Systems. For more information about supported switches, see System Requirements and Supported Platforms on Siebel SupportWeb.

To specify extensions for a teleset

  1. Navigate to Administration - Communications > All Telesets.
  2. In the All Telesets view, select the record for the teleset to which you add extensions.
  3. Click the Extensions view tab.
  4. In the Extensions list, add a new record to create a new extension record.
  5. In the Extension field, enter the extension.
  6. In the Extension Type field, specify the type, as required for the switch:
    • "S" stands for standard DN: for all supported switch types, specify one extension of this type for each teleset.
    • "A" stands for the ACD DN: this extension type is only used for Nortel Meridian switches.
